What Moon teaches is no more Scriptural than that which you will find in the New York Times. His doctrine is that God put Adam and Eve on the earth to create the perfect human family. When Eve had sexual liaisons with the serpent (an allegory of Lucifer), God cast man out of the Garden. Every two thousand years God sent another perfect man to find his Eve, and fulfill the Plan of the Ages (create that perfect family). When Jesus came (who Moon claims to have been the bastard son of Zechariah and Mary) his mission was to, as perfect man, find his Eve and raise the perfect family on earth. Since he was crucified he never met that goal. Says Moon, "The Cross is the symbol of the defeat of Christianity".

Moon teaches that he is the new Messiah, the next one after Christ sent to the earth to create the perfect human family. When he married his fourth wife (I guess it's hard to find the right Eve) this event was regarded by his followers as "the marriage of the Lamb".
Young people, disillusioned with the often sterile Churches they find themselves in, often flock to his meetings. Weekend retreats are full of flattery, "love bombing", smiles, and a strong sense of belonging. Once these visitors become members in the Unification Church they are bombarded by Moon's teachings. Brainwashing techniques (sleep deprivation, intense indoctrination, exhaustion) are commonly reported by those who have escaped the movement.
"Moonies" feel that the Holy Bible is no longer revelant in this era. Their new Messiah, Moon, supposedly entered the spirit world and, after exhaustive conferences with Buddha, Jesus, and other "perfect men", wrote down these new truths in Moon's 536 page Divine Principle.
Unification Church members live together communally, donating all their worldly possessions to the cause. Members often pan handle in large cities, bringing in up to $1600 per member on each outing. The Unification Church routinely engages in occult practices shunned by the Orthodox Christian Church. They support clairvoyance and mediumistic trances. Any spot sprinkled with soil from Korea is considered to be holy ground, since this was the country Messiah came from. If members fail to do their part to support the activities of the Church, Moon publicly attacks them as sloths who are against building the Kingdom of Heaven on earth.

The Person of GodGod, being the first cause of all creation, also exists because of a reciprocal relationship between the dual characteristics of positivity and negativity .. we call the positivity and negativity of God "masculinity" and "femininity" respectively (Moon, Divine Principle, p. 24) Man is the visible, and God the invisible form. God and man are one. Man is incarnate God .. as important in value as God Himself (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 5) God is just like you and me. All human traits originate in God (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 4) |

The Lord Jesus ChristHe was the one who lived God's ideal in fullest realization (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 12) In light of his attained deity he may be well called God. Nevertheless, he can by no means be called God Himself (Moon, Divine Principle, p. 210-211) The death of Jesus was neither his will nor his fault. It was murder, and his body was taken by Satan (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p.104) Jesus came as the sinless Adam, or perfected Adam. His first mission was to restore his bride and form the first family of God. But he was crucified. Jesus Christ must come again to consummate the mission he left undone 2000 years ago (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 27) Korea should be the nation that can receive the Lord of the Second Advent (Moon, Divine Principle, p. 520) Even in the spirit world after his resurrection, he lives as a spirit man with his disciples (Moon, Divine Principle, p. 212) |

The Nature of SalvationGod's work has been the restoration of original goodness ... to do this job God needs certain tools. The religions of the world have served as these tools for God ... Christianity may be considered the most advanced and progressive religion because it teaches this sacrificial love and duty in supreme form (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 17-18) Christ will come as before, as a man in the flesh, and he will establish a family through marriage to his Bride, a woman in the flesh and they will become the True Parents of all mankind. Through our accepting the True Parents (the Second Coming of Christ), obeying them and following them, our original sin will be eliminated and we will eventually become perfect (Declaration of Unification Theological Affirmations at Barrytown, New York, October 14, 1976) God intended to make Adam and Eve one in Heavenly matrimony. Then they would have borne sinless children and become the true mother and father for all mankind ... establishing the heavenly kingdom on earth (Moon, Christianity in Crisis, p. 26) |
